Innovative Education and Lifelong Learning

At nae Inc., we believe that learning is not a phase—it is a lifelong process.
And design has a unique role to play in reimagining how we learn, at every stage of life.
In today’s complex world, the ability to keep learning as an adult is becoming more essential than ever. We envision a society where people can grow by expanding their capabilities in alignment with their evolving interests. This also applies to children—who, from early childhood, should be able to explore deeply and confidently in the directions that spark their curiosity.
Design brings to education more than aesthetics—it brings a mindset.
As seen in innovative approaches like Reggio Emilia, the ability to observe, question, and reflect is core to learning. These skills are not just for children—they are vital throughout life.
We also see design as a method for framing and pursuing meaningful questions.
Beyond formal structures of teaching and instruction, learning is driven by curiosity, creativity, and the desire to act. Designers are trained to learn whatever tools are needed to bring their questions to life—and that posture can empower all kinds of learners.
At nae Inc., we are particularly passionate about child-centered education, and see it as one of the most important investments in the future.
By redesigning the way learning environments are shaped—at home, in schools, and in communities—we aim to contribute to a future where creativity, agency, and purpose are central to how we grow.
